Helicopter Crash in Pune: All Occupants Safe but Injured

A helicopter en route from Mumbai to Hyderabad crashed in Pune’s Mulshi tehsil on Saturday afternoon, authorities reported. The incident occurred near Paud, and fortunately, all four occupants of the helicopter survived the crash. However, they may have sustained injuries.

The helicopter, which belongs to Global Vectra, was flying when it went down in the Mulshi tehsil area. Emergency services promptly responded to the scene. The captain of the helicopter is currently being transported to a hospital for medical evaluation, while the other three individuals on board are reported to be in stable condition.

The exact cause of the crash is still under investigation, and authorities are working to determine the factors leading to the incident. An official stated that the investigation into the crash is ongoing, and more details will be provided as they become available.
